Title: Mosswood schema registry returns stale compatibility mode after update

Steps: update subject compat from BACKWARD to FULL, re-fetch within 60s. Old mode returned intermittently; cache TTL not invalidated on write. Workaround: restart the registry pod. Fix should bust cache in the update handler. Reproduced on the build identified below.

build token for tawip-yageg: htk9_92ac43d42

# Break-Glass Access — CrashFunnel Pipeline

External plugin authors normally cannot touch the CrashFunnel ingestion tier. If your plugin wedges the symbolication queue and the Duty Owl is unreachable, break-glass access is permitted for read-only triage only. All sessions are recorded and reviewed. To open the break-glass console, enter the passphrase below.

unlock words, fafop-hawep: briwyn-oliix-sorox

## 2.8.0 — Changed Defaults

Sweepwright's data-retention sweeper now runs hourly instead of daily, and soft-deletes are purged after 30 days instead of 90. Existing deployments are not auto-migrated; update your overrides or inherit the new defaults on next restart. Dry-run mode remains off by default. The new default configuration ships as follows.

config for bawig-fadup:
[zorix]
host = zorix.lumicworks.corp
user = zorix_svc
database = zorix_prod